Rio de Janeiro

Ports of Call Excursion: Rio de Janeiro

Rio de Janeiro, capital of the State of Rio de Janeiro, and also Brazil's capital from 1763 to 1961, is nestled between the mountains and the sea. Its magnificent shoreline includes charming bays and beautiful beaches, dotted with islands up and down the coast. Flying into Rio is a beautiful sight, whether it be at night or during the day, the visitor quickly finds out why Rio is known as the Wonderful City. The center for art and fashion.

Maracana Visit or Game match: depends on the day of the match
Price: $86 per person
Duration: 3 hours
Probably the world's most famous football stadium, Maracana is able to hold 100,000 spectators. Going to the Maracana is an unforgettable experience. Most games take place on Sundays, but only those involving the big local teams will give you the kind of atmosphere that Maracana is famous for. A visit to the stadium itself during the day can be easily arranged and combined with any city tour.

Sugar Loaf
Price: $63 per person
Duration: 4 hours
Drive to "Praia Vermelha", to take the two-stage car up to the top of Sugar Loaf (270m), which grants the entrance to Rio's harbor and Guanabara Bay. The first stage is Morro da Urca with 170m, with a restaurant, amphitheatre and helicopter-point. The second stage goes on the Sugar Loaf itself.
